  2. The more expensive courier fees are just for specific time slots, so you could pay to get it potentially a few hours earlier but other than that there is no way of speeding it up.

    Personally I would probably book my flight for two weeks after the interview, with the understanding that I may have to change my plans.

    Jock told me there was no option to get it "faster" just earlier. His interview was yesterday and we set up a flight for the 29th. We scheduled it a few weeks ago though with the thinking that it would be cheaper to pay the change fee IF he had to reschedule his flight rather than pay for a ticket just before he intended to fly. And at last look the ticket we got him in now almost twice the price so I am glad we did it this way.

  7. Hi

    My interview is in London on Wednesday and I am just running through all my stuff to make sure I have everything to travel down tomorrow. Is there a checklist of all the forms I need to take with me just so I can make sure. I am fretting that I will forget something.

    Thanks so much

    Nicky

    Hi there, my fiance is going for his interview on Wednesday too!! Good luck :)

    You need to have:

    • 2 US Passport Sized photos
    • Your Passport
    • Your interview letter
    • Your Receipt for paying the visa
    • Copies and originals of your: Birth Certificate, Police Certificate and Divorce Decree (if applicable)Show the originals and give them the copies.
    • Your I-134 affidavit of support document and supporting evidence
    • Copies of forms from your medical (just in case) but dont give up originals you'll need them for AOS.
    • Any proof of relationship evidence that you may want to bring although I hear over and over they don't ask for it. Better to have than not I guess.
    • A debit card or charge card cause the DX Secure courier service does NOT TAKE CASH!

    and I think that's it. Keep us posted on what happens please :thumbs:
